The Boston University Art Galleries presents an exclusive area screening of K8 Hardy’s structuralist and experimental film,Outfitumentary, at the Brattle Theatre as part of the 808 Gallery exhibition Forms & Alterations. Hardy's film is both performance and video record of the artist’s changing sense of self and style over an eleven-year period. In 2001, before the ubiquity of Instagram and selfies, Hardy set out to document her daily outfits on a fairly consistent, if not daily basis. She used the same mini-DV camera and filmed in ever-changing living spaces and art studios in New York. The resulting 80-minute film is an affecting and personal exploration of queer identity and the way in which the materiality of the body and its subsequent “outfitting” – in private and public life – serves to refine, define, and probe the body politic.
